/** This function will create a thread with a message from the user as the first message */
CreateThread(userMessage = undefined) {
return __awaiter(this, void 0, void 0, function* () {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
var options = userMessage ? { messages: [{ role: 'user', content: userMessage }] } : undefined;
this.client.beta.threads.create(options)
.then(data => resolve(data.id))
.catch(err => reject(err));
});
});
}
/** This method creates a run in a thread. It will read the last messages and generate a response based off them
* The method will only return a value once the run has reached a final state
*/
CreateRun(threadId, assistantId, extraInstructions = undefined, additionalMessages = undefined, withFileSearch = false, withCodeInterpreter = false) {
return __awaiter(this, void 0, void 0, function* () {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
var options = {
assistant_id: assistantId,
additional_instructions: extraInstructions,
additional_messages: additionalMessages,
};
if (withFileSearch || withCodeInterpreter) {
options.tool_choice = 'required';
if (withFileSearch)
options.tools = [{ 'type': 'file_search' }];
if (withCodeInterpreter)
options.tools = [{ 'type': 'code_interpreter' }];
}
this.client.beta.threads.runs.createAndPoll(threadId, options, { pollIntervalMs: 1000 })
.then(data => {
if (data.status == 'completed')
resolve(data.id);
else
reject(data);
})
.catch(err => reject(err));
});
});
}

/** This method adds a message in a thread. Messages are not read by the AI until you create a run */
AddMessage(threadId, message, role) {
return __awaiter(this, void 0, void 0, function* () {
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
this.client.beta.threads.messages.create(threadId, { content: message, role: role })
.then(data => resolve(data.id))
.catch(err => reject(err));
});
});
}
